Behind the Scenes at The Magical Media Blogger Retreat

When I first started my blog, I didn’t know a single soul who also blogged. I was alone and on my own to learn the business. I slowly but surely started going to blogger conferences and meeting more bloggers, and each time I went learned a little more about how to grow my blog and monetize my business. Being a blogger is actually very lucrative and staying on top of trends, learning shortcuts, and knowing the tricks of the trade will only help you grow your audience and your wallet. Thus after 5+ years of attending these types of events and even speaking at them, my friends Jenny from Princess Turned Mom and Justine from Little Dove Blog and I decided to join forces and create our own blogger retreat/conference weekend! As you know, I love planning events, and this was the first overnight one, and I can’t wait to do more!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

So in January, the inaugural Magical Media Retreat was born and it was a success! We intentionally wanted to make the retreat intimate, so we limited tickets to 20 attendees. And not only did we all have a blast, we all learned multiple new things for our business. We spent the weekend making long-lasting bonds, cultivating friendships, leaning on each other for support, and inspiring each other to grow!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

The weekend retreat took place at the Radisson Blu in Anaheim. It was the perfect hotel for the retreat because it is close to Disneyland and had the perfect sized conference room for our event! Plus, the rooms were incredible! I cannot wait to take my entire family back soon! You can read more about the hotel here!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

After we welcomed everyone to the retreat on the rooftop of The Radisson Blu, we took the Ride Art bus to Downtown Disney! You can scan a QR code right from the hotel lobby and ride all day to the parks for only $6 per person!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Then we had dinner at the incredible Naples Ristorante. We were given a private outdoor room on the rooftop of the restaurant and were treated to Sangria, wine, sodas, salads, gluten free pasta, pizza, and dessert. I can’t even begin to describe how good everything was, especially the pasts, and also how kind, helpful, and patient the staff was, and how amazing the view of Downtown Disney was! They were extremely generous and I cannot wait to go back!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

The next day was the actual retreat, where we spent most of the day, learning from each other and our two keynote speakers, Angela Kim from Mommy Diary and Heather Brooker from Motherhood in Hollywood! I have been friends with Angela and Heather for years and I just adore them as humans and moms and also learn so much from them as business professionals. I even had the opportunity to moderate a Q&A with Heather!

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

I also had the privilege to speak about “How to Network, Build Long Term Relationships and Think Outside the Box with Brands, and Know Your Worth!” I love public speaking and I truly hope I was able to share some good advice to this group of moms!

I am that mom who wants to do it all and when I get overwhelmed or start suffering from a major case of burnout, I feel guilty if I take a break instead of giving my body and mind permission to slow down or even stop. 

As moms we often feel guilty if we take a break or believe we are perceived as weak if we ask for help. I have learned that the more I ask for help and the more time I take for myself, the better I am for my children. 

Guilt is an emotional response to something you perceived you did wrong, but when you experience unnecessary guilt, it’s counterproductive to healing and helping you with what you need most. For the last 3 years I have spent my career therapeutically helping families and children of all ages on the Autism Spectrum. Play has been a fundamental way for many of my clients to communicate if they are non-verbal. And some of my clients have had to be taught how to play with a toy or another person. The play ideas listed on the blog can be used with children with or without special needs. Play is a universal way a child can explore their world in a way that makes sense to them and cultivate imagination, creativity, and fun! As a Registered Play Therapist, I love the work I do and couldn’t be prouder of the progress my clients have made with play over the years! #drkimblog
